Power meters are devices that measure the electrical power being used by a device or circuit. They are commonly used for monitoring energy consumption, optimizing energy efficiency, and billing purposes. Power meters measure voltage and current and calculate real power, reactive power, apparent power, power factor, and other electrical parameters.
